Memset is defined as taking destination, c, count (#3335)

Signed-off-by: Alan Jowett <alan.jowett@microsoft.com>
Co-authored-by: Alan Jowett <alan.jowett@microsoft.com>
This commit is contained in:
Alan Jowett 2024-03-07 17:15:29 -08:00 коммит произвёл GitHub
Родитель f7bf6d0c92
Коммит f237860470
Не найден ключ, соответствующий данной подписи
Идентификатор ключа GPG: B5690EEEBB952194
2 изменённых файлов: 2 добавлений и 2 удалений

Просмотреть файл

@ -409,7 +409,7 @@ EBPF_HELPER(
#if __clang__ #if __clang__
#define memcpy(dest, src, dest_size) bpf_memcpy(dest, dest_size, src, dest_size) #define memcpy(dest, src, dest_size) bpf_memcpy(dest, dest_size, src, dest_size)
#define memcmp(mem1, mem2, mem1_size) bpf_memcmp(mem1, mem1_size, mem2, mem1_size) #define memcmp(mem1, mem2, mem1_size) bpf_memcmp(mem1, mem1_size, mem2, mem1_size)
#define memset(mem, mem_size, value) bpf_memset(mem, mem_size, value) #define memset(mem, value, mem_size) bpf_memset(mem, mem_size, value)
#define memmove(dest, src, dest_size) bpf_memmove(dest, dest_size, src, dest_size) #define memmove(dest, src, dest_size) bpf_memmove(dest, dest_size, src, dest_size)
#define memcpy_s bpf_memcpy #define memcpy_s bpf_memcpy
#define memmove_s bpf_memmove #define memmove_s bpf_memmove

Просмотреть файл

@ -61,7 +61,7 @@ UtilityTest(bind_md_t* ctx)
} }
// Verify that memset overwrites the first string with 0. // Verify that memset overwrites the first string with 0.
if (memset(test1, 4, 0) == 0) { if (memset(test1, 0, 4) == 0) {
return 6; return 6;
} }